Premium Photo Electronic Board: Ultimate Visual Clarity & Style

A premium photo electronic board elevates imaging performance by integrating high-speed signal processing with low-noise sensor interfaces. Designed for professional cameras, medical imaging, and industrial inspection, these boards deliver sharper detail, higher frame rates, and reliable data throughput.

Engineered for demanding environments, a premium photo electronic board combines advanced layout techniques with robust power delivery to minimize artifacts and latency. This results in consistent image quality, accurate color reproduction, and support for the latest high-resolution sensor technologies.

High Speed Data Path Architecture

The premium photo electronic board uses a high speed data path architecture that minimizes bottlenecks between the sensor and host system. Wide memory interfaces and optimized DMA engines ensure that burst sequences from high resolution sensors remain intact and free of frame drops.

Signal integrity is maintained through controlled impedance traces, shielding, and calibration routines that compensate for temperature drift. This architecture supports multi lane configurations and compression options, enabling longer cable runs without degradation in image quality.

Low Noise And High Dynamic Range Imaging

Noise performance is critical for low light and medical applications, and a premium photo electronic board integrates dedicated analog front end components. These include low noise amplifiers, precision voltage references, and adaptive gain control that preserve shadow detail without raising the noise floor.

High dynamic range imaging is achieved through advanced pixel processing, scalable tone mapping, and frame stacking techniques. The board handles simultaneous noise reduction and edge enhancement, so details remain visible in both highlights and deep shadows.

Embedded Processing And Firmware Flexibility

Modern boards include an embedded processing core that handles preprocessing tasks such as demosaicing, white balance, and defect correction. This offloads the host system and reduces overall latency, which is essential for real time monitoring and automated inspection workflows.

Firmware updates add new sensor profiles, update algorithms for color science, and improve compatibility with emerging interface standards. Developers can access SDKs to customize preprocessing pipelines, enabling tailored solutions for surveillance, spectroscopy, or industrial measurement.

Cooling, Reliability, And Environmental Robustness

Thermal design is a major factor for sustained performance, and a premium photo electronic board incorporates robust cooling solutions. Larger heatsinks, thermal pads, and forced air or liquid cooling keep junction temperatures within safe limits during continuous 24/7 operation.

Reliability is further enhanced by high quality capacitors, reinforced connectors, and protection against voltage surges. Boards suited for harsh environments may include conformal coating, wide temperature range components, and vibration resistance to ensure stable imaging in the field.

Implementation Best Practices And Recommendations

  • Validate sensor and board electrical specifications, including voltage levels and timing margins, on paper before prototyping.
  • Use high quality cabling, proper grounding, and shielding to preserve signal integrity in noisy industrial settings.
  • Implement thermal testing under full load to confirm that temperatures remain within spec across the operating range.
  • Plan firmware update procedures and version control to ensure long term stability and easy maintenance.
  • Evaluate total cost of ownership, including power, cooling, and support, rather than only initial purchase price.

Can a premium photo electronic board improve the performance of my existing camera system?

Yes, upgrading to a premium board can raise throughput margin, reduce noise, and enable higher resolution or faster frame rates, provided the host system and sensors are compatible.

How do I verify that a board supports my specific sensor model before purchase?

Check the official compatibility list provided by the manufacturer and confirm electrical, timing, and interface settings match your sensor datasheet.

What are the power delivery requirements for a premium photo electronic board in a compact enclosure?

Review the board’s voltage rails, peak current, and thermal design, then use appropriately rated power supply modules and adequate heatsinking to avoid throttling.

What kind of developer support and software tools come with a premium photo electronic board?

Look for comprehensive SDKs, sample code, detailed documentation, and responsive technical support to streamline integration and debugging.
